Since metal pipes and fittings can add up to be pretty expensive real quick, I decided that for the outdoor curtains I would try a cheaper version of using plastic pvc pipes and fittings. Then I painted them black to go with my decor. Looks Sooo beautiful, can't even tell they're plastic !!! Also in the middle of the pvc pipe I put a brace to give it more strength to hold the somewhat heavy curtains. I'm so excited to try your other projects. Thank you so much for sharing.

    Pro tip, _always_ make certain your bird houses have a hinged roof section, with a closure hook. If you can't open it up to clean it out every year, the birds stop using it. This is because it gets mouldy & too stinky to use. Happy spring time everyone!🤗🇨🇦
